Definitions

gǎn yellowcheek (Elopichthys bambusa)

Etymology

About

The simplified character (traditional ) is a phono-semantic compound: the fish radical (the simplified form of ) gives its meaning, and the phonetic (gǎn, 'to feel' or 'sense') indicates the pronunciation. This radical categorizes it as a fish, and the character designates the yellowcheek, a large predatory freshwater fish endemic to East Asia.
